The 2-wire design on the Red Lion RL12G05 is what makes this pump special. Most submersible pumps require an external control box. This one doesn’t. That alone saves $100+ and reduces points of failure.
The Franklin Electric motor inside is American-made and respected across the industry. Even professional installers pair Franklin motors with other pump brands for this reason. The 212 ft shut-off head handles wells down to about 150 feet realistically.

At 12 GPM, this pump supports 1-2 bathroom homes comfortably. It won’t win any flow rate contests, but the simplicity and reliability make it a favorite for replacement applications. The steel casing with thermoplastic discharge balances durability and cost.
NSF/ANSI 372 certification means it’s safe for potable water. The built-in check valve and suction screen reduce installation steps. The included waterproof splice kit gets you connected to power without buying extra parts.
One thing to consider: 2-wire pumps are slightly louder than 3-wire models because the start capacitor is in the pump itself rather than a remote control box. For deep wells where the pump is hundreds of feet down, this is irrelevant. For shallow installations, it matters more.
When to choose 2-wire over 3-wire
2-wire pumps work best for residential applications with standard pressure switch controls. They’re simpler to wire, easier to troubleshoot, and have fewer components that can fail. If your electrical panel can supply 230V directly to the pump, 2-wire is the cleanest solution.
3-wire pumps with external control boxes offer better diagnostic features and easier motor repair in some cases. For most homeowners, 2-wire is the better choice because of its simplicity.

Shallow vs deep well conversion process
For shallow wells (0-25 ft), the pump uses a single pipe configuration with a foot valve. This is the simpler setup and works for most residential wells in areas with high water tables.
For deep wells (26-90 ft), you need to add a two-pipe jet assembly. This ejector kit mounts at the well bottom and uses the pump’s pressure to lift water from greater depths. The conversion process takes an hour or two with basic plumbing tools.
Common installation challenges
Priming can be tricky. If the pump doesn’t prime on the first try, check all connections for air leaks. Even a small leak in the suction line prevents proper priming. Some users needed to re-seat fittings with thread tape to get a complete seal.
Factory leaks are an occasional issue. Test the pump with water before installing it in your well system. Running it on a bucket test for 10 minutes verifies all seals are tight before you commit to permanent installation.

How to Choose the Best Well Pump for Your Home?
Choosing the best well pumps for homes requires understanding your well depth, water demand, and electrical setup. The wrong pump costs more in the long run through premature failure, high energy bills, or poor water pressure.

Well depth determines pump type
Shallow wells (under 25 feet) work with jet pumps. These sit above ground in a well house or basement and pull water up through suction. They’re easier to install and service because you don’t need to pull them out of the well.
Deep wells (over 25 feet) need submersible pumps. These drop down into the well casing and push water up. They handle depths from 25 feet to 400+ feet depending on the model. Submersibles are more efficient for deep wells and run quieter because the pump is underwater.
For wells between 25-90 feet, you have options. Convertible jet pumps work in this range with the right jet assembly, though submersibles are often more efficient. Above 90 feet, submersibles are the clear choice.
GPM and household demand
GPM (gallons per minute) measures how much water the pump delivers. A typical household needs 6-12 GPM for normal use. Higher demand households with 3+ bathrooms, irrigation systems, or large families need 15-25 GPM.
Calculate your peak demand by adding up fixture flow rates. A shower uses 2.5 GPM, a washing machine uses 3-5 GPM, and a dishwasher uses 2-3 GPM. If your peak demand is 15 GPM, you need a pump that delivers at least that much at your operating pressure.
Don’t oversize GPM beyond your actual need. Larger pumps cost more to buy and run. Match the pump to your household’s realistic peak demand, not maximum possible usage.
Head pressure and well depth
Head pressure (measured in feet) is how high the pump can push water. It needs to cover the well depth plus the distance to your home plus the height of any fixtures. A pump with 150 ft head can serve a 100 ft well with 50 ft of remaining head for household pressure.
Total dynamic head includes friction losses in pipes. Long pipe runs, narrow pipes, and many fittings all reduce effective head. Add 10-20% to your calculated head for friction losses in typical residential installations.
Electrical requirements
115V pumps work with standard household circuits. They’re easier to install for DIYers but draw more current. 230V pumps require dedicated circuits from your breaker panel but run more efficiently. Most submersible pumps are 230V because of the efficiency advantage.
Verify your electrical panel has capacity for the pump circuit before purchasing. A 1 HP submersible at 230V typically needs a 20-amp double-pole breaker and 10-gauge wire. For longer runs (50+ feet), step up to 8-gauge wire to prevent voltage drop.
Pressure tank pairing
The pressure tank works with your pump to maintain consistent water pressure. An undersized tank causes the pump to cycle on and off rapidly, wearing out the motor. A properly sized tank extends pump life significantly.
For most homes, a 20-gallon pressure tank pairs with pumps delivering up to 15 GPM. Larger homes or higher-flow pumps benefit from 30-50 gallon tanks. Our guide to well pressure tanks covers sizing and selection in detail.
Brand reliability and warranty
Grundfos, Franklin Electric, Goulds, and Pentair consistently rank as the most reliable brands in installer forums. They cost more but last longer. Budget brands like VEVOR and Hallmark Industries offer good value but with more variable longevity.
Warranty length matters, but so does warranty service. A 3-year warranty from a company with poor service is worth less than a 1-year warranty from a company that honors claims quickly. Read warranty reviews before purchasing premium pumps.
Installation considerations
DIY installation is possible for shallow well jet pumps if you’re comfortable with plumbing and basic electrical work. Deep well submersible installation typically requires professional help because of the well pulling equipment and electrical work involved.
Professional installation costs $500-1,500 depending on your location and well depth. This is worth budgeting for complex installations. For replacement pumps that swap with existing units, DIY is often feasible. For new installations, professional help prevents costly mistakes.
Frequently Asked Questions
How many years does a well pump usually last?
Most residential well pumps last 10-15 years with proper installation and maintenance. Submersible pumps in clean water with adequate pressure tanks commonly reach 15+ years. Jet pumps average 10-12 years. Hard water, sandy conditions, and frequent cycling reduce lifespan significantly.

What type of pump is best for well water?
Submersible pumps are best for wells over 25 feet deep. They run quieter, are more efficient, and handle deep wells better than jet pumps. For shallow wells under 25 feet, jet pumps work well and are easier to service. Convertible jet pumps handle both shallow and moderately deep wells (25-90 feet).
How much does it cost to get a new well pump installed?
Professional well pump installation costs $500-1,500 for labor, depending on well depth and location. The pump itself runs $200-2,500. Total replacement costs typically fall between $700-4,000 including parts, labor, and electrical work. Deep well submersible installations cost more than shallow well jet pump replacements.
